Reese's Peanut Butter Cups are an American candy by The Hershey Company consisting of a peanut butter filling encased in chocolate. They were created on November 15, 1928, by H. B. Reese, a former dairy farmer and shipping foreman for Milton S. Hershey.Reese left his job with Hershey to start his own candy business. Gluten-free foods must contain less than 20 parts per million (ppm) gluten. Foods may be labeled "gluten-free" if they are inherently gluten free; or do not contain an ingredient that is: 1) a gluten-containing grain (e.g., spelt wheat); 2) derived from a gluten-containing grain that has not been processed to remove gluten (e.g., wheat flour); or 3) derived from a gluten-containing grain.
